    Great fun and romance, 2007-01-03
    I loved this movie. It is predictable on how it will turn out, but it is a warm, fun, romantic story. Kimberly Williams and Patrick Dempsey work well together and make such a good couple that you are hoping they will get together the whole movie. It is good entertainment if you like romantic movies.

    Finding Mr. Right..., 2006-10-13
    We all have a picture of who our Mr. Right should be; how he should look, dress, act and be. This movie shows you that you can meet your presumed Mr. Right and it still doesn't fit because your soul mate sometimes comes in a package you least expect. I don't want to give too much of this movie away. Just watch it. It's a good lesson for us gals in our mid to late twenties plugging on through life and searching for the one.
